It\u2019s no secret that Logan Paul became one of the internet\u2019s most hated influencers after filming a video in Japan\u2019s Aokigahara Forest in 2017. The footage showed the body of a recently-deceased suicide victim, and Paul saw immense backlash as a result. Paul received punishment from YouTube and even saw his content removed from Google Preferred, among being the talk of the entire world for months \u2014 but in the midst of all the backlash, he took an unexpected step forward by getting into a beef with British creator KSI, which resulted in a boxing match that changed the YouTube landscape. Paul and KSI\u2019s initial match ended in a draw, and the two faced off again in 2019, where KSI emerged victorious. Despite his loss in the split-decision bout, Paul has seen immense growth ever since, boasting a hugely popular podcast and even scoring a fight with Floyd Mayweather. In a surprising turn of events (owing to their infamous rivalry), the YouTuber attributed his current success to KSI, claiming that their boxing beef had started a new chapter in his life and kickstarted his eventual comeback.
